Cost and Insurance
Cost is often a consideration for patients. The cost of breast lift surgery can vary depending on the hospital, the surgeon's fees, the complexity of the procedure, and the geographical location. It is important to get a detailed cost estimate from the hospital and understand what is included in the price. Additionally, check with your insurance provider to see if they cover any part of the breast lift surgery. In some cases, breast lift surgery may be covered if it is deemed medically necessary, such as in cases of severe breast sagging causing back or neck pain.
Understanding Breast Lift Surgery
What is Breast Lift Surgery?
Breast lift surgery, or mastopexy, is a surgical procedure designed to raise and reshape the breasts by removing excess skin and tightening the surrounding tissue. This helps to support and contour a new, rejuvenated breast profile. The procedure can address breasts that have sagged or lost volume due to aging, weight fluctuations, pregnancy, or genetics.
Types of Breast Lift Techniques
There are several common breast lift techniques, each suitable for different degrees of breast sagging:
- Circumareolar Mastopexy: Also known as a “doughnut” or “periareolar” breast lift, the incision is made around the areola only. It is suitable for mild sagging and can also reduce the size of the areola.
- Circumvertical Mastopexy: A short - scar breast lift with an incision made around the areola and a vertical line heading downwards, resembling a lollipop. It can address moderate sagging and allows for more skin and tissue removal compared to circumareolar mastopexy.
- Wise - Pattern Mastopexy: Also called the “inverted - t” lift. The incision is made around the areola, a vertical line down the bottom of the breast, and a horizontal line along the breast crease. This technique is recommended for more extensive lifting needs and significant sagging.
- Augmentation Mastopexy: This is a combination of breast lift and breast augmentation using implants. It is suitable for patients who want to increase breast volume along with lifting the breasts.
Who is a Good Candidate for Breast Lift Surgery?
Good candidates for breast lift surgery typically have the following characteristics:
- They have saggy breasts that have lost their shape and volume.
- They have areolas and nipples that point downward.
- They are non - smokers or are willing to quit before and after surgery, as smoking can impair healing.
- They are at a stable, healthy weight, as significant weight fluctuations after surgery can affect the results.
- They are done breastfeeding and/or having children, as pregnancy and breastfeeding can cause changes in the breasts.
The Recovery Process
The recovery process after breast lift surgery usually involves the following stages:
- Immediate Post - Operative Period: After the surgery, patients are moved to a recovery room where they are monitored. They may experience mild swelling, bruising, and discomfort, which can be managed with pain medication. A soft surgical bra is usually worn to provide support.
- First Week: Most patients can go home the same day or within a few hours after the surgery. During the first week, they should rest and avoid strenuous activities. Slight pain and swelling are normal, and the medical team will provide instructions on wound care and follow - up appointments.
- Return to Normal Activities: Many patients can resume light activities within a week or two, but strenuous exercise or heavy lifting should be avoided for at least 4 - 6 weeks. The final results of the breast lift will gradually become more apparent as the swelling subsides over a few weeks to months.
Risks and Complications of Breast Lift Surgery
Like any surgical procedure, breast lift surgery carries some risks and potential complications:
- Infection: There is a risk of infection at the incision site. To minimize this risk, patients are usually prescribed antibiotics and are given instructions on proper wound care.
- Bleeding: Some bleeding may occur during or after the surgery. In most cases, it can be managed, but in rare cases, additional surgical intervention may be required.
- Scarring: All breast lift surgeries result in some scarring. However, skilled surgeons try to place the incisions in inconspicuous locations, and the scars usually fade over time. Some individuals may be more prone to excessive scarring or keloid formation.
- Changes in Nipple Sensation: Temporary or, in rare cases, long - term changes in nipple sensation can occur. This can include decreased or increased sensitivity.
- Asymmetry: There may be a slight difference in the shape or position of the breasts after the surgery. In some cases, revisional surgery may be required to correct this.
- Breastfeeding Changes: Breast lift surgery can potentially affect a woman's ability to breastfeed. However, in most cases, the nipple - areola complex is preserved to minimize this risk.
It is important for patients to have a thorough discussion with their surgeon about these risks before deciding to undergo breast lift surgery.
